Output 68fe900886525312a9509054006a5106aa42624f6b444fcd4f899afaa8af8c1e:1

value
30434501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6465f50347858f502ea2a97bc6081ae0bf377537 OP_EQUAL
address
3Aqsdq2zohTCvhdH7NYbiCQk7xwJj53t7u
transaction
68fe900886525312a9509054006a5106aa42624f6b444fcd4f899afaa8af8c1e
spent
true